Understanding the Total Chimney inspection and cleaning cost in Today's Market
As you budgeting for seasonal upkeep, understanding the Chimney inspection and cleaning cost remains highly necessary.
The overall price for these critical services typically relies on several variables, including:
- The local area and the standard service prices.
- The degree of soot accumulation found inside the chimney.
- If the Chimney inspection and cleaning cost covers basic fixes.
- Your chimney's height and the difficulty of its structure.
- The additional equipment needed to effectively clean the system.

FAQ Regarding Fireplace Services
- Q: When is it best to get a Chimney inspection?
A: Most sweeps recommend scheduling a Chimney inspection minimum annually. This guarantees that any buildup or wear is fixed prior to it creates a safety threat. - Q: Can you explain the typical website Chimney inspection and cleaning cost?
A: The Chimney inspection and cleaning cost generally varies between $150 to $400 based on the state of the chimney. Factors like excessive soot or required repairs can influence the final price. - Q: What makes a expert Fireplace inspection more effective than looking at it myself?
A: A professional Fireplace inspection employs advanced cameras to view parts of the chimney that are totally impossible to see otherwise. Their expertise prevents unknown flaws from causing potential structural fires.
